About This Facility

Situated in the heart of Iowa City, IA, Community and Family Resources is your go-to destination for a wide array of addiction treatment services. This facility stands out by offering a blend of intensive outpatient treatment and outpatient care, with specialized programs tailored specifically for adolescents. What sets this center apart is its focus on both substance use issues and co-occurring mental health disorders, making it a valuable resource for individuals facing these challenges. They provide not only treatment but also transitional housing and sober living options, offering a supportive environment for those navigating their recovery journey. You’ll find a variety of treatment approaches here, including 12-step facilitation and anger management therapies, designed to support both adults and children/adolescents of any gender.
